Service accounts — Ledgerlight audit-log viewer. Each environment gets one read-only account; never reuse across staging and prod. Accounts are provisioned through the Mossvane identity console and expire every 90 days. The viewer queries the Tarnfield event store directly, so scope is limited to the audit index. For the eng-sync demo environment, a shared demo account exists. Its key for the Tarnfield API is below.

app token of badug-tahaf = qvz11-nP5FBNr8qnh

MEMO — Velstram Region Sales Review

Welcome aboard. Ahead of your first quarter, please review the Velstram region's performance. Revenue grew 6% year on year, driven largely by the Corvane product line, though the Ashfield and Lunet territories underperformed against plan by 9% and 12% respectively. Pipeline coverage sits at 2.1x, below our 3x target, and average deal cycles lengthened by eleven days. Marit Olsover has prepared detailed territory files for your review. Before your onboarding session, please read the following carefully.

board note of kagep-yahig: Only 9 of the 120 pilot accounts renewed Quenix, so a churn review is set for April 1.

**Q: Why aren't all my plugin's log lines showing up in Chatterlens?**

Short answer: sampling. The Murmurbus service is chatty enough that we only keep about 1 in 50 debug-level lines during peak hours. Errors and warnings always get through, so don't panic. If your plugin genuinely needs full-fidelity logs for a debugging session, you can request a temporary sampling exemption for your namespace. The steps and the request form live on our internal page.

operations page: https://jira.lumiclabs.internal/pages/display/projects/af69ce92